One killed, six injured as car rolls down in Ramban | | | Early Times Report Jammu, July 10: One person was killed, another goes missing while six others including two children sustained injuries when a Maruti Car on its way from Srinagar to Doda, skidded off the road and rolled down into river Chanab. One person yet Police spokesperson said, the incident took place when the ill fated vehicle reached near Karol, Ramban and driver lost control over the vehicle without registration number but bearing engine number 4466654 which rolled down into river Chanab. Soon-after receiving the information about the accident a team led by DySP Hqrs Ramban Perbeet Singh Parihar rushed to the spot and started rescue operation under the close supervision of Anil Magotra, SP Ramban. Police rescued six injured namely as Mohd Altaf S/o Mohd Ramzan R/o Chapnari Banihal, Mushtaq Ahmed S/o Abdullah Malik , Saqib Hussain S/o Noor Mohd. R/o Jarkote, Mohd Jahangir S/o Gh. Nabi R/o Tatna, Shamima Begum w/o Ab. Rashid R/o Dongar, Khursheed Ahmed S/o Ab Rashid R/o Doda. However, one girl namely Rubina Bano D/o Ad Rashid R/o Dongar could not be traced from the site of accident. All the injured persons were immediately shifted to District Hospital Ramban for necessary treatments where one injured namely Khursheed Ahmed S/o Ab. Rashid R/o Doda succumbed to his injuries. The dead body of the deceased handed over to his legal heir for last rites. Meanwhile police has registered a case under FIR No. 102/2012 u/s 279/337/304-A RPC at Police Station Ramban and further investigation is in progress. |
